Output e3068962fa587a1e16823bc5011e7cc30b5b1c875f65d9a29b3fed14179ee26f:0

value
12800
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3addf5d809d00d2c95f5518a73bfc53de4c0e087886f7195e4ab141729bff1ec
address
ltc1p8twltkqf6qxje9042x9880798hjvpcy83phhr90y4v2pw2dl78kqdkj5l3
transaction
e3068962fa587a1e16823bc5011e7cc30b5b1c875f65d9a29b3fed14179ee26f
spent
true